Using this dog collar is easy. First, measure your dog's neck accurately and follow the fitting instructions to choose the right size. When putting it on your dog, make sure it's not too tight or too loose. You should be able to fit two fingers comfortably between the collar and your dog's neck. As for maintenance, keep it away from water and extreme heat. If it gets dirty, you can use a soft, damp cloth to gently wipe it clean. Check the buckle and dee regularly to ensure they are in good working condition. This way, your dog's collar will last a long time.
